Leveraging Competitor Benchmarking to Enhance Your Social Media Reach
In today’s digital landscape, understanding where you stand in relation to your competitors is crucial for enhancing your social media reach. Competitor analysis allows businesses to identify what types of content resonate with target audiences and what strategies successful competitors are utilizing. By analyzing their social media profiles, engagement rates, and follower interactions, you can adopt strategies that have proven effective in your industry. This process involves more than just observing; it requires collecting data on competitors’ post frequency, audience engagement, and content types. Furthermore, tools like social media analytics can really help to streamline this analysis. In addition to understanding successful approaches, analyzing competitors can also reveal gaps in your strategy, such as underperforming platforms or content styles. Evaluating your competitors’ strengths will enable your brand to position itself effectively within the market. It can assist in discovering topics that are currently trending or uncovering opportunities for innovative content. Overall, an in-depth competitor analysis ultimately plays a vital role in crafting a more targeted and impactful social media strategy for superior reach and engagement.
Once you’ve gathered essential competitor data, the next step is to summarize your findings effectively. Choose key metrics from your analysis and compare them against your own social media efforts. Start with evaluating engagement rates, posting frequency, and content variety between your competitors and yourself. This analysis will shed light on whether you are lagging in certain areas, or if you have a distinctive edge that can be leveraged further. Use visual tools like graphs or tables to display this comparative data clearly. Highlight areas where your competitors excel and determine which strategies you can adapt or innovate upon. Additionally, identifying the types of content—be it video, infographics, or blog posts—that generate the most engagement for competitors will guide your content creation efforts. As you create your summary, remember to focus not only on your competitors’ strengths but also on their weaknesses. Understanding their shortcomings can also offer a unique opportunity for differentiation. Craft a compelling value proposition that sets you apart based on these insights, thereby enhancing your overall social media strategy.
Implementing Findings into Your Strategy
With a solid understanding of competitor performance metrics, it’s time to implement your findings into a comprehensive social media strategy. Begin by establishing clear objectives based on insights gained from competitor analysis. Align these objectives with your overall business goals to enhance coherence. Adjust your content calendars to reflect successful posting trends observed from your competitors. For instance, if rivals consistently post on weekends or during specific hours, consider experimenting with similar schedules. Innovative content ideas inspired by competitors are also important; try repurposing successful formats while ensuring that your content remains unique to your brand identity. Regularly monitor audience responses to newly implemented strategies to fine-tune approaches further. Use A/B testing to determine what imagery, messaging, or hashtags resonate best with your target audience. Regularly revisit competitor analysis to stay updated with the rapidly evolving landscape. A dynamic approach, based on both your and your competitors’ performances, will enable you to remain competitive and relevant in the social media sphere, connecting more effectively with your audience.
As you refine your social media strategy, utilizing tools for monitoring and analytics becomes essential. Platforms like Hootsuite, Sprout Social, and Buffer provide powerful insights into engagement patterns and audience sentiment. These tools allow you to track your posts’ performance and compare it with competitors’ activities seamlessly. Regularly analyze metrics such as likes, shares, comments, and follower growth. Additionally, focus on engagement quality rather than solely on quantity, as this offers deeper insights into your audience’s preferences. Understand which communities engage with your posts the most; this knowledge can guide targeted advertising strategies and collaborations. It’s vital to remain adaptable, as social media trends shift rapidly. Stay informed about emerging platforms and technologies that competitors may be exploring to harness new opportunities. Notably, include your audience in the conversation; utilizing polls and surveys can be invaluable in gathering real-time feedback on your content. Adapting your approach based on data-driven insights will help you maintain an impactful online presence while consistently enhancing your social media reach.
Evaluating Your Competitor Analysis Periodically
Competitor analysis isn’t a one-off task; it requires ongoing evaluation and adjustment. Social media landscapes are dynamic, with algorithms, trends, and audience preferences changing rapidly. To stay ahead, consider conducting competitor reviews quarterly or bi-annually. This periodic evaluation should include tracking any new entrants into your industry, as well as shifts in competitors’ strategies. Assess how their recent campaigns performed and what lessons can be learned from them. Don’t just look at established competitors; emerging brands can also offer innovative approaches worth examining. Keep a close eye on their engagement tactics, visual styles, and audience interactions. Additionally, re-evaluate your performance in comparison to updated competitor metrics. Use this information to adjust your approach to content marketing and audience engagement to ensure sustained growth. Remember to involve your team in these reviews; diverse perspectives can unveil new strategies and opportunities. Establishing a routine for competitor assessments will create a culture of continuous improvement, aligning your social media efforts with the most effective practices in your industry.
